2 definitions found From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48 [gcide]: Hematinic \He`ma*tin"ic\, n. [From {Hematin}.] (Med.) Any substance, such as an iron salt or organic compound containing iron, which when ingested tends to increase the hemoglobin contents of the blood. [Webster 1913 Suppl.] From WordNet (r) 2.0 [wn]: hematinic n : a medicine that increases the hemoglobin content of the blood; used to treat iron-deficiency anemia [syn: {haematinic}]
